Famotidine represents a histamine H2-receptor antagonist, effectively inhibiting the release of gastric acid. This action reduces the symptoms of various gastrointestinal disorders, such as peptic ulcers, gastroesophageal reflux disease (GERD), and Zollinger-Ellison syndrome. Famotidine's mechanistic profile exhibits a relatively long half-life, allowing for once-daily dosing and enhanced patient adherence. Clinical trials have shown that famotidine is significantly effective in treating these conditions, with minimal adverse reactions. Furthermore, its safety profile makes it a well-received choice among healthcare practitioners.

Tailoring Famotidine Therapy for Acid-Related Diseases
Famotidine, a potent histamine H2 receptor antagonist, is widely utilized in the management of acid-related disorders. Nevertheless, achieving optimal therapeutic outcomes necessitates careful consideration of individual patient factors and disease severity. A comprehensive approach to famotidine therapy involves choosing an appropriate dose, observing response, and modifying the regimen as needed.
Factors influencing quantity decisions include age, renal function, comorbid conditions, and the specific acid-related disease being managed. Regular monitoring of symptoms and clinical parameters is essential to assess therapeutic efficacy. If desired control is not achieved, dose escalation may be considered within the recommended guidelines. Conversely, if side effects occur or manifestations improve excessively, decreasing may be necessary.
Close collaboration between healthcare providers and patients is indispensable to ensure safe and effective famotidine therapy. Open communication regarding therapy progress, potential benefits, and any adverse effects allows for timely adjustments and improved patient outcomes.

Evaluating the Risk Assessment of Famotidine
Famotidine is a common medication used sitio web to manage conditions such as ulcers and heartburn. Before taking any new drug, it's essential to become aware of its potential unwanted consequences. Famotidine generally has a positive safety profile when used as directed.
However, like all medications, it can sometimes cause negative effects in some individuals. Typical side effects may include headache, dizziness, and diarrhea. These effects are usually temporary and resolve on their own.
In infrequent instances, more severe side effects may occur. It's crucial to speak with your doctor immediately if you experience any unusual symptoms while taking famotidine. This features allergic reactions, such as skin rash, itching, or swelling. Therefore, famotidine is a generally safe medication when used appropriately. However, it's important to be mindful of its potential side effects and to seek medical attention if you experience any concerns.
